The selection of the right technology framework is highly valued for the purposes of designing modern and interactive online applications. Vue.js has emerged as the favorite of almost all developers due to its flexibility, ease of use, and depth of features. Not only is it sufficient to mention that the right framework must be available like Vue.js, it is equally necessary to work with the right Vue.js development partner for the project to be a success. However, why dignify the process of partner selection and how does one go about this needful, yet very delicate undertaking?
What is Vue.js?
Vue.js is a widely adopted JavaScript framework that focuses development of user interfaces. Based on such, Vue.js is a unique framework that can be scaled up to any desired level. The core library targets the view layer of the application and hence can be easily connected to other libraries and already-developed applications. From building a simple static website to developing a large-scale and complex application that can be deployed in a cloud environment, you can turn to Vue.js to fulfill different levels of development strategy.
Benefits of Using Vue.js for Modern Web Development
Vue.js stands out due to its lightweight architecture and fast performance. Here are some benefits that make it ideal for web development:
- Easy Integration: The beauty of Vue.js is that it can be worked in coordination with applications from other libraries.
- Two-Way Data Binding: Allows seamless synchronization between the data model and the view.
- Component-Based Architecture: Eases the process of writing clean as well as modular code that promotes reuse.
Why Vue.js is the Best Choice for Your Project
Vue.js offers several key advantages for businesses looking to build responsive, scalable, and high-performance applications. Its ease of use, combined with its ability to scale for large projects, makes it the perfect choice for startups and enterprises alike.
Flexibility and Scalability of Vue.js
Companies provide it with all the necessary features for the creation of any applications from simple to very comprehensive including enterprise applications. Because of its flexible design, developers can customize the framework depending on the needs of their project hence it is a growing solution that accommodates the changes within the needs of the company.
Lightweight Framework for Fast Applications
With Vue js the size of the framework is small which leads to reduced time of loading the pages and better performance of the application. As such it is most suitable for designing applications that are performance-oriented and require speed like shopping carts and real-time applications.
Understanding Vue.js Development Services
This means that when you decide to hire a VueJS Development Company, you also hope to receive creativity, know-how, and efforts directed towards actualizing the idea, rather than just coders.
Key Services Offered by a VueJS Development Company
Most VueJS Development Services include:
- Custom Application Development: Custom-made applications, developed in accordance with the requirements of a specific client’s business model.
- Single Page Applications (SPAs): Fast-loading apps that improve user experience.
- Maintenance and Support: Ongoing support to ensure the app runs smoothly.
Common Use Cases for Vue.js in Web Applications
Vue.js is commonly used for:
- E-commerce platforms.
- Real-time chat applications.
- Interactive dashboards and data visualization tools.
The Role of a VueJS Development Partner
A VueJS Development Partner acts more like a developer consultant to you, walking you through the full cycle of tech development. From the first stage of development, which is conception, to the final stage, post-launch support, you can consider your project done successfully.
The Importance of Expertise and Experience
It is such a development partner who should be of great assistance to you, for he is well versed with so many aspects within the Vue.js ecosystem. This knowledge assists in avoiding those mistakes that are typical and also helps them finish the development process quite fast and with good quality.
How to Hire the Right VueJS Developer
Choosing the right VueJS Developer is a task that requires intense care. Clearly, it is not enough for the developer to possess technical qualifications. There’s more to it, they should also have an insight into your business needs.
Essential Skills to Look For
When hiring a VueJS Developer, focus on these essential skills:
- Proficiency in JavaScript, HTML, and CSS.
- Experience with Vue.js frameworks and libraries.
- Ability to work in a team and communicate effectively.
Key Questions to Ask Your Vue.js Development Partner
Before you hire, make sure to ask these important questions:
- What is your experience with Vue.js projects?
- Can you provide case studies or examples of your previous work?
- How do you approach project management and timelines?
Benefits of Hiring a VueJS Development Company
Even though it may appear that one can get a worthwhile bargain by opting for a solo developer, in reality, utilizing a full-fledged VueJS Development Company has a lot more advantages than an individual developer. You get a team of experts, enhanced project delivery, and continued service.
Comprehensive Team Support
A company offers an entire team which calls workforces, and project leads, including design and application mobile developers as such and hence guarantees 100% completion of your project at all phases.
Vue.js Development for Scalable Solutions
Vue.js fits well and is the best choice for scalable web applications since it is built to expand your organization.
Examples of Scalable Projects Built Using Vue.js
Many large-scale companies, such as Alibaba and Xiaomi, rely on Vue.js for their front-end development due to its ability to handle high-traffic environments.
Customized Vue.js Development Services
All businesses are different and drivers of that particular business call for appropriate VueJS Development Services to be able to customize.
Flexibility in Service Offerings
Choose a partner who can provide you with comprehensive services or help in scaling up or scaling any aspect of the project in accordance with growth in business.
Vue.js for E-commerce Solutions
E-commerce websites made using Vue.js are usually fast, considerate, and very efficient in that the customers can use them without a hitch.
Real-World Examples of E-commerce Sites Using Vue.js
Major e-commerce platforms like Lazada and Alibaba have utilized Vue.js to improve site performance and user experience.
Vue.js for Real-time Applications
Vue.js is a perfect solution for chat applications, live streams, and other real-time applications as it is inherently reactive in nature.
Integration with Other Technologies for Real-Time Functionality
Embedded application-orientated concepts such as streaming may use CSML, which is Node.js compatible so that it aids in building Vue.js applications.
Cost Considerations When Hiring VueJS Developers
When hiring a VueJS Developer or a development company, it is important to consider many other factors, such as the complexity of the project, the period of performance, and the experience of the developer.
Budgeting Tips for Vue.js Projects
- Set clear project goals: Knowing exactly what you need helps in avoiding unnecessary costs.
- Plan for post-launch support: Factor in maintenance costs for long-term success.
How to Ensure Project Success with Your VueJS Development Partner
Leverage the fact that communication is key to success in any endeavor and help manage appropriately each other’s expectations at the beginning of any engagement and at each stage of the Project.
Establishing Milestones and Deliverables
Work with your development partner and prepare a timeline for the project with the key milestones included. This helps keep the project on the course, as well as coordinates the movements of all the participants concerning the tasks.
Conclusion
A careful choice of a VueJS Development Company is the decisive step toward success in your project. The success or failure of a launch can depend on the skills, experience, and willingness to realize the idea of the chosen partners. As a result, by focusing on appropriate recruitment, asking informative questions, and clarifying the aims, there’s no doubt that the scope of your Vue.js project will be met and even surpassed.